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ft covers the month of May 2022. The report specifically documents the voting results from the company's 2022 Annual General Meeting of Shareholders, which was held on May 19, 2022.

Guidance, Outlook, and Risks
The filing includes a standard disclaimer regarding forward-looking statements, noting they are based on current plans and estimates. Key risks identified include:
- Conditions in financial markets across Germany, Europe, and the United States.
- Potential defaults of borrowers or trading counterparties.
- Implementation of strategic initiatives.
- Reliability of risk management policies and procedures.
For detailed risk factors, the filing refers investors to the 2021 Annual Report on Form 20-F (pages 12 through 53).
